Performs scheduled preventative maintenance.Maintains and lubricates machine tools and equipment.Dismantles machine or equipment to examine parts for defect or to remove defective part.Operate the equipment within set parameters.Ensure the equipment is maintained and in safe, clean and working order.Responsible for protecting the environment from spills and housekeeping throughout the day.Responsible for helping manage the move in / move out hours.Calls supervisor for availability of trucks.Plans job activities in advance of moving in and starting a job.Manages expenses and revenue associated with rig operations.Makes notes on bid-jobs denoting time on bid and time bid.Makes notes on the tickets when you call for services such as vacuum trucks, wireline, haul trucks, etc.Keep a daily time log with a break down from one process to another.Observes and listens to operating machines or equipment to diagnose machine malfunction and determine need for adjustment or repair.This position is accountable for day-to-day drilling rig maintenance on a wide variety of drilling equipment. Performs related duties as assigned which may not be specifically listed in the job description, but which are within the general occupational series and responsibility level associated with the incumbents’ class of work.Profit/Loss job reviews of all major workovers and Plug/Abandon.Preventive maintenance plan on all equipment and rigs.Daily review/analysis of all workover rig reports submitted by tool pushers.Plan/bid P&A, fishing methods and select tools for removing obstacles, such as liners, broken casing, screens, and drill pipe, from wells.Examines and inspects work progress, equipment, and construction sites to verify safety and to ensure that specifications are met.
